The postcode LS29 6EP is located in Bradford, in the county of West Yorkshire.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. LS29 6EP is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

LS29 6EP is one of the least de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 8.1 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of LS29 6EP as Suburbanites > Suburban achievers > Ageing in suburbia.

The closest road name to LS29 6EP is Fairfax Avenue which is centered 15 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Menston Rail Stn and is 400 m away. The closest railway station is Menston Rail Station, 365 m away.

The closest primary school to LS29 6EP (for ages 11 and under) is Menston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on April 24, 2018.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is St. Mary's Menston, a Catholic Voluntary Academy. The last OFSTED inspection on November 26, 2014 rated this school as Outstanding

The local pub for residents of LS29 6EP is The Malt Shovel and is 386 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Satisfactory on May 28, 2019. The nearest takeaway food is available from Menston Spice and is 350 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on February 27, 2019.

Residents reported an average download speed of 13.7 Mbps and an average upload speed of 3.3 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 75%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ps. 25% of residents have broadband access of 10-30 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 3.3 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.4 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for LS29 6EP is covered by the West Yorkshire police force association and Bradford and Airedale Teaching is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
